Sean Southall

Late Red Card and Penalty Condemn Chasetown to 2–0 Away Loss against 1874 Northwich.

The match got off to an active start as Chasetown threatened early on.

In the 7th minute, Chasetown started brightly, displaying great link-up play in the opening exchanges.

Shortly after, in the 11th minute, Chasetown earned an early corner, which was gathered up safely by the 1874 Northwich goalkeeper.

Once play settled, Chasetown maintained relentless pressure through the opening twenty minutes, but 1874 Northwich's defense kept them at bay.

1874 Northwich found their rhythm as the first half progressed, forcing a save from Chasetown goalkeeper Curtis Pond in the 29th minute.

Despite a brief set-piece display from both sides late in the first half, solid defending from Chasetown kept 1874 Northwich from breaking through, heading into the interval deadlocked at 0-0.

The second half saw Chasetown maintain pressure from the whistle, with Jack Langston volleying just over the crossbar in the 48th minute and Tak Sambizi testing 1874 Northwich goalkeeper shortly after with a shot on goal that was calmly claimed by the 1874 Northwich goalkeeper.

In the 58th minute, Kyle Moseley was played through on goal, but his strike was denied by a great save from the 1874 Northwich goalkeeper to keep the scoreline level.

A setback struck 1874 Northwich in the 60th minute when a player suffered an injury requiring medical attention, though he recovered and play resumed.

1874 Northwich began dominating the flanks, forcing keeper Curtis Pond into a brilliant fingertip save in the 64th minute.

The breakthrough came in the 69th minute when 1874 Northwich's Ben Crane found the back of the net to break the deadlock and give 1874 Northwich a 1-0 lead.

Both managers turned to their benches to refresh their lineups, with Chasetown introducing Matt Funge and Tom Thorley to push for an equalizer.

However, a setback struck Chasetown in the 81st minute when Nathan Cameron was shown a red card, leaving Chasetown down to 10 men.

1874 Northwich capitalized immediately when they were awarded a penalty in the 82nd minute following a foul in the box, which was converted cleanly past Curtis Pond by 1874 Northwich's John McGrath.

Chasetown turned to their bench again in the 84th minute to introduce Ethan Patterson, but 1874 Northwich held firm to wrap up a hard-fought 2-0 triumph.
